The postcode SP1 3DA is located in Wiltshire It was introduced in January 1980 and is an active postcode. SP1 3DA is a small user postcode that may contain upto 100 addresses (but 15 is more typical).

SP1 3DA is one of the less deprived areas in the country. It rates as a 7.3 on the scale of the index of deprivation (where 10 are the least deprived and 0 are the most deprived areas). The 2011 UK census classified the residents of SP1 3DA as Urbanites > Ageing urban living > Communal retirement.

The closest road name to SP1 3DA is Victoria Road which is centered 69 m away.

The nearest bus stop is Butts Road and is 172 m away. The closest railway station is Salisbury Rail Station, 1.1 km away.

The closest primary school to SP1 3DA (for ages 11 and under) is St Mark's CofE Junior School, Salisbury. It achieved an OFSTED rating of Good on February 27, 2020. The closest secondary school (for ages 11-18) is South Wilts Grammar School. The last OFSTED inspection on October 23, 2019 rated this school as Good

Residents reported an average download speed of 100.2 Mbps and an average upload speed of 16.9 Mbps in a 2017 OFCOM broadband survey. 100% of residents have broadband access of ultrafast 300+ Mbps. 100% of residents have broadband access of superfast 30-300 Mbps.

Gas consumption for the area is rated at 3.1 out of 10. Where 0 are the lowest and 10 are the highest consuming areas in the country respectively.

Policing for SP1 3DA is covered by the Wiltshire police force association and Wiltshire is the NHS Primary Care Trust (PCT) or Care Trust Plus (CT).
